The Supply Line Break Water Removal Process: What to Expect

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that your supply line break is handled with the utmost care. We’ll start by shutting off the main water supply to prevent further damage, then use specialized equipment to extract the water and assess the extent of the damage.

Step 1: Assess and Contain

Within 60 minutes of arrival, our technicians will assess the situation and contain the affected area to prevent further water damage. This may involve moving furniture, covering walls, and blocking off adjacent rooms.

Step 2: Extract Water

Using high-capacity pumps and state-of-the-art equipment, our team will extract the water from your home as quickly and efficiently as possible. This process typically takes 1-3 hours, depending on the extent of the damage.

Step 3: Inspect and Dry

Using specialized equipment our technicians will inspect your home for any signs of hidden water damage or potential hazards. We’ll also use high-velocity air movers to dry the affected area, ensuring your home is safe and healthy.

Step 4: Document and Report

Thorough documentation is key to a successful insurance claim. Our team will take detailed photos, notes, and videos to ensure that your insurance company has a clear understanding of the damage and the repairs required.

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Don’t ignore the signs of water damage – musty odors can be a sign of hidden moisture and potential mold growth. If you notice a persistent, unpleasant smell in your home, it’s time to call our team.

Warped or Discolored Flooring

Water damage can be hidden beneath your floors. If you notice warped or discolored flooring, it may be a sign of a larger issue – don’t wait until it’s too late.

Water Stains on Walls or Ceilings

Water stains can be a sign of a much larger issue. If you notice water stains on your walls or ceilings, it’s time to call our team to assess the damage.
